About Elvira Madueme
Elvira Madueme is a Nigerian-born IFBB Figure Pro athlete who began her competitive bodybuilding career later in life and achieved prominence across multiple divisions. She is best known for winning the 2023 IFBB Masters World Championships Pro in the Figure 40+ category, a significant milestone that established her standing in the sport at an age when many athletes are concluding their competitive careers.
Madueme's competition record spans from 2022 onward. She won the 2022 NPC Worldwide Ben Weider Natural Pro Qualifier in the Figure 35+ and 40+ Overall category before placing fifth at the 2022 IFBB Ben Weider Natural Pro Figure competition. Her breakthrough came in 2023 when she captured the Masters World Pro title in the Figure 40+ division. Since then, Madueme has competed in Women's Bodybuilding, winning first place at the 2025 IFBB Battle of the Bodies Pro and the 2025 IFBB Triple O Dynasty Pro, both in the Women's Bodybuilding division. Her competitive trajectory demonstrates progression across age-bracket and divisional categories, with consistent top finishes in recent years.
